  • How to fly to South Padre Island?

    You cannot fly directly to South Padre Island. KAYAK recommends you fly to Brownsville South Padre Is. Intl (BRO) (21.35 miles from South Padre Island). From there you can rent a car or get a taxi.

  • What airports are near South Padre Island?

    The closest airport is Brownsville South Padre Is. Intl (BRO) (21.35 mi). Other nearby airports are Harlingen Valley Intl (HRL) (31.2 mi), Matamoros (MAM) (32.39 mi) or McAllen Miller Intl (MFE) (66.5 mi). KAYAK recommends you fly to Brownsville South Padre Is. Intl.

  • How far is Brownsville South Padre Is. Intl Airport from central Brownsville?

    The city center of Brownsville is 4 miles from Brownsville South Padre Is. Intl Airport.

  • What is the name of Brownsville’s airport?

    There is only 1 airport in Brownsville, called Brownsville South Padre Is. Intl Airport (BRO). It can also be referred to as South Padre or South Padre Is. Intl.
